Extraction of the Envelope of Radio Impulse Signals Using the Digital Processing Methods Based on Correlation Fucntion and Hilbert Transform

Статья в сборнике трудов конференции

The article presents the results of extracting the envelope of radio impulse signals using the digital processing methods. Three methods of extracting the envelope are studied in the work: correlation function; the Hilbert transform; and the new approach in which the combination of correlation function and Hilbert transform are used. For the research we used the measured reflectograms of the multilayer liquid. As a result of processing and comparing a variety of experimental characteristics the accuracy of determination of Hilbertcorrelation combination sequence was better than standard methods of processing. The resulting waveform is easier to analyze and process, but the processing need more time to calculate.
